WordNet-Online
Free dictionary and thesaurus of English. Definitions, synonyms, antonyms and more...
Hint: double-click any word to get it searched!

Google
 

scabbard

 

Definitions from WordNet

Noun scabbard has 1 sense
  1. scabbard - a sheath for a sword or dagger or bayonet
    --1 is a kind of
    sheath

Definitions from the Web

Scabbard

Noun:

  • A sheath for a sword, knife, or dagger.
  • A protective covering or case for a blade, typically made of leather, metal, or plastic.

Example Sentences:

  • He unsheathed his sword from the scabbard and prepared for battle.
  • The knight's scabbard was expertly crafted from engraved steel.

Related Products:

sbsequently sbsolescence sbstinate sbw sc sc s scab scab formed on a burn scabbard scabbed scabby scabicide scabies scabiosa scabiosa arvensis scabiosa atropurpurea scabious

Sponsored (shop thru our affiliate link to help maintain this site):

WordNet-Online
Home | Free dictionary software | Copyright notice | Contact us | WordNet dictionary | Automotive thesaurus